<script type="text/javascript">
function getbillno(tbl){
$.get("getbillno.php?tbl="+ tbl, function(bill){
$("#billno").val(bill); });
}
</script>
快速概述:函数 getbillno(tbl) 默认返回显示 1(ELSE echo "1")。
问题:在 IE 中,无论我显示什么,即使页面是空白,它也总是显示 1。
我没有点击刷新,而是尝试关闭 IE(9),它确实显示了正确的值。我再次更改了代码中的值,然后刷新了 IE,它会显示之前的值 - 这是我重新打开 IE 后的值。
问题:是否有我必须在 IE(9) 中更改或配置的设置或其他内容?
在我发现关闭浏览器会做什么之前,我一直在互联网上提问。我认为这与我的程序有关,或者也许确实如此 - 所以这里有一些链接。就像背景一样,因为我不确定看到我的其他问题是否会改变很多。
[1] $.get 在 IE 中不起作用
[2] 有没有办法用 $.get 之外的事件调用 php?
IE缓存获取请求
您可以使用以下命令禁用此功能缓存:假jquery获取参数
默认值:true,对于数据类型“script”和“jsonp”为 false 如果设置为
false,它将强制浏览器不缓存请求的页面。
将缓存设置为 false 还会附加一个查询字符串参数,
“_=[TIMESTAMP]”,到 URL。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)